The top new NYC stores for holiday dresses and party outfits in 2025

It’s Sequin Season Again!

New Year’s Eve is almost here, and that means it’s time to hunt for the perfect party attire—think fabulous dresses, feathered outfits, and chic bodysuits. If you’re in New York, there are five exciting new stores to explore as you embrace the festive spirit.

LoveShackFancy’s New Flagship

Located in SoHo, LoveShackFancy just opened a dreamy flagship store. It’s a beautiful space filled with pink tones and floral designs, adored by celebrities like Kate Hudson and Sofia Vergara. Here, you can find everything from ruffled dresses to romantic velvet outfits and delicate lace bustiers. Don’t forget to stop at the in-store beauty bar for a spritz or two of Ribbon Top Eau de Parfum. Sounds delightful, right?

Alice + Olivia’s Dramatic Redesign

Stacey Bendet, the founder of Alice + Olivia, is known for her bold sense of style, and the brand’s Upper East Side flagship showcases that perfectly. This fall, the store got a stunning makeover, featuring a ruby-red mosaic front, stylish furniture, and a unique dressing room akin to a treasure box. It’s the perfect place to flaunt metallic jacquard mini-dresses, sequined pants, and elegant satin ball gowns. There’s just so much to celebrate in this lively environment.

Mango’s Party Collection

If you’re hunting for sharp tuxedos or sexy little black dresses, Mango’s got you covered. Their latest Upper West Side shop, the fourth in New York, showcases a new party collection released by model Kaia Gerber. Expect to see gorgeous lace bodysuits, trendy cropped jackets, flared pants, and classy evening dresses. It’s everything you need to make a statement at the latest events.

Annie’s Ibiza – A Sparkling New Spot

With a focus on all things shiny, Annie’s Ibiza is a must-visit for New Year’s festivities. Annie Doble has opened her new Soho store after successful launches in Ibiza and London. The place is a treasure trove of vintage finds, designer collaborations, and her own artisanal creations. Among them is a unique Mercer dress inspired by stained glass—a true gem for New York shoppers. Oh, and there’s plenty of champagne available too!

Retrofête Shines Bright

If dazzling dresses are more your style, check out Retrofête. Known for their stunning looks, one of their glittering pieces made waves when Beyoncé wore a mirror minidress to an event, stirring quite a buzz on social media. Recently, they opened a revamped store in Soho, filled with essentials for a night out, including the sparkling Gabrielle dress, which has been sported by Taylor Swift. It’s all about the party here!
